Was never a fan of the all pick swaps/deferrals but it was still worth it.
We will have our 2020 & 2021 1st
NO gets 2022 1st
2023 pick swap option
2024 or 2025 1st (likely 2025, since LeBron will he likely retired)
Basically NO has control over our picks for the next 5 year window. 2022-2025
How much longer will this LeBron/AD window be? I see 3 more years. Will need to find 3rd star.
